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

Apple Logo

Software Developer in Test (SDET), Creativity Apps

Apple

$147,400 - $272,100
Aug 13, 2025
Cupertino, CA, US
Apply Now

Apple is looking for a full-stack Software Developer in Test to test iOS/macOS apps, cloud based frameworks and APIs, with a focus on contributing to innovative tools for creative professionals, video makers and visual storytellers.

Requirements

  • experience in testing iOS/macOS apps, cloud based frameworks and APIs
  • programming in Swift and/or Python to prototype features, and create and test with internal tools
  • Testing mobile/desktop apps, cloud based frameworks, and backend/APIs
  • At least one modern web framework: React, Angular or Ember
  • Strong knowledge of software development lifecycle, testing methodologies, QA terminology and processes
  • Understand system interdependencies
  • Bug detection, isolation, and regression skill

Responsibilities

  • planning, designing, writing, maintaining and executing test cases manually and through automation using Swift, Python or JavaScript
  • drive all aspects of quality and process improvements
  • Reporting bugs with outstanding isolation and regression techniques
  • balancing a wide variety of deliverables
  • managing priorities and communicating progress and risks effectively and systematically
  • ongoing curiosity and dedication to self-education in video technologies as well as new testing techniques
  • working closely with other team members to help coordinate multi-functional test efforts

Other

  • passion and/or background in video editing
  • Bachelor's Degree in Computer Science or an equivalent of 5 plus years relevant experience required
  • Analytical, methodical, inquisitive and persistent problem solver committed to driving quality forward
  • Ability to abstract technical details and effectively communicate to audiences at different levels
  • Proficient at balancing multiple efforts simultaneously and meeting strict deadlines